Columbia College Missouri holds a strong position among schools offering business administration & management. More specifically it was ranked #1,559 out of 2,012 schools by College Factual. It is also ranked #37 in Missouri.
In the most recent year for which we have data, Columbia College handed out 51 bachelor’s degrees in business administration & management.
Business Administration & Management majors who earn their bachelor’s degree from Columbia College Missouri earn a median of $53,404 a year. This is higher than $50,642, the median for all majors at Columbia College Missouri.
Earning a bachelor’s degree at Columbia College Missouri, business administration & management students borrow a median amount of $33,703 in student loans. This is above $29,021, the typical median for all majors at Columbia College Missouri.

Among recent graduates, 45% of business administration & management bachelor’s degrees went to men and 55% went to women.
The largest share of business administration & management bachelor’s degree graduates at Columbia College Missouri were White. Approximately 69%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Columbia College with a bachelor’s in business administration & management.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 1 |
| Black or African American | 7 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 1 |
| White | 35 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 4 |
| Other Races | 3 |

This business administration & management program at Columbia College Missouri breaks down into the following more specific areas of study:
| Concentration | Annual Graduates |
|---|---|
| Business Administration and Management, General | 49 |
| Organizational Leadership | 7 |
| Project Management | 1 |
Columbia College Missouri conferred 49 degrees in business administration and management, general in the latest year of data — 53% to women and 47% to men. The largest share of these graduates were White (67%). This count includes degrees completed through distance education.
Columbia College Missouri conferred 7 degrees in organizational leadership recently — 57% to women and 43% to men. The most common background among these graduates was White (57%). This count includes degrees completed through distance education.
